alvherre@commandprompt.com wrote: >... > but ISTM ljb is the one who needs to find what works ... Here's my Makefile for testing this: =========================== all: f1 f2 f3 f4 f5 f6 f1:echo \#define SYSCONFDIR "" > f1 f2:echo \#define SYSCONFDIR \"\" > f2 f3:echo "#define SYSCONFDIR \"\"" > f3 f4:echo '\#define SYSCONFDIR ""' > f4 f5:echo '#define SYSCONFDIR ""' > f5 f6:echo #define SYSCONFDIR "" > f6 =========================== I'm using make from "Borland C++ 5.5.1 for Win32" on Windows 2000. Here are the results for the first 4 cases: f1: #define SYSCONFDIR "" f2: #define SYSCONFDIR \"\" f3: "#define SYSCONFDIR \"\"" f4: '#define SYSCONFDIR ""' Cases 'f5' and 'f6' don't produce output files at all. So it seems to me that the patch to bcc32.mak should be reverted (as shown below), but that depends on what the original poster (Mark Morgan Lloyd) says. If he says the patch is needed, we should figure out why we get different results. --- src/interfaces/libpq/bcc32.mak.orig 2006-04-24 00:03:42.000000000 -0400 +++ src/interfaces/libpq/bcc32.mak 2006-05-30 19:40:31.000000000 -0400 @@ -141,7 +141,7 @@# Have to use \# so # isn't treated as a comment, but MSVC doesn't like thispg_config_paths.h: bcc32.mak - echo \#define SYSCONFDIR \"\" > pg_config_paths.h + echo \#define SYSCONFDIR "" > pg_config_paths.h"$(OUTDIR)" : @if not exist "$(OUTDIR)/$(NULL)" mkdir "$(OUTDIR)"
